  1. Goa is the favorite tourist destination in India for honeymoon and bachelor parties. It is also the popular go-to holiday place for both Indians and foreigners. This state is located on the west coast of India which comes under Konkan coastal belt. Apart from its beaches and nightlife, this tourist paradise offers rich culture, history and nature trails to chill, relax, and rejuvenate. Popularly known as the Pearl of the Orient, Goa portrays mixed culture and heritage of Portugal and India at its best. Be it a cultural tour, spiritual, heritage or recreational one, the land of beaches offers a unique experience for every tourist.   2. Calangute Beach: • Located in the North Goa, it is the biggest of the beaches and is aptly named Queen of the beaches with its vast expanse of sand and ocean waters. It is popular for both domestic and international travelers with its festive mood and seafood cuisine. Adventure activities like parasailing, surfing, jet skiing and banana rides add fun to the tourists.

  3. Basilica of Bom Jesus: • Churches are an important part of Portuguese culture and legacy. This basilica is considered as a heritage site by UNESCO for its well-preserved architecture. The church contains the mortal remains of St Francis which are well preserved and is revered by Christians as pilgrim site. It is one of the oldest churches in India and is quite popular for its architectural designs dating back to 1605.

  4. Baga Beach: • This beach is most sought out for the ambiance it offers and water recreation activities. The scenic shoreline gives a spectacular view of fishing boats and lets you experience the culture of the finest fishing village. Tourists enjoy basking in the sun and dolphin spotting apart from the boat rides.

  5. Fort Aguada: • It is one of the best preserved Portuguese forts in India over a period of 400 years. Built in the early 17th century the fort defended well from invaders and offers a scenic view of the convergence of river Mandovi and the Arabian Sea. Built with laterite stone, the Portugal military architecture is well represented in its form. The 4 storeyed lighthouse is the tourist attraction in the fort. Part of the fort is turned into jail and is considered the biggest of jails in Goa.
